Transaction 66bc1653a73d169cd3d4e33f0ee9e72e62133fc20bcc887400266216011bbd84
1 Input
1 Output
-
66bc1653a73d169cd3d4e33f0ee9e72e62133fc20bcc887400266216011bbd84:0
- value
- 877950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cddadaac046e7455ccddd81fcaca1415fe8db9f6 OP_EQUAL
- address
- 3LTUd8B698tuYz8svQSfA4U6yg1BXSbQVX